First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

Remove casualty to fresh air and keep warm and at rest. If breathing is irregular or stopped, administer artificial respiration. In case of respiratory tract irritation, consult a physician. Provide fresh air.

Symptoms: Respiratory complaints, Asthmatic complaints.

Skin contact

Wash immediately with: Water and soap. Do not wash with: Solvents/Thinner. In case of skin irritation, consult a physician.

Eye contact

In case of contact with eyes flush immediately with plenty of flowing water for 10 to 15 minutes holding eyelids apart and consult an ophthalmologist.

Ingestion

Do NOT induce vomiting. Rinse mouth thoroughly with water. Let water be drunken in little sips (dilution effect).

Immediate Medical Attention

In case of allergic symptoms, especially in the breathing area, seek medical advice immediately. In case of accident or unwellness, seek medical advice immediately.

Medical Treatment

Treat symptomatically.

Handling and Storage

Safe handling precautions, storage conditions, and workplace requirements

Handling

Persons with a history of skin sensitisation problems should not be employed in any process in which this product is used. It is recommended to design all work processes always so that the following is excluded: Inhalation of vapours or spray/mists. Skin contact. Eye contact. Only use the material in places where open light, fire and other flammable sources can be kept away. Handle and open container with care. When using do not eat, drink, smoke, sniff.

Storage

Keep only in the original container in a cool, well-ventilated place. Keep container tightly closed. Floors should be impervious, resistant to liquids and easy to clean. Restrict access to stockrooms. Protect against Heat. UV-radiation/sunlight.

Hygiene

When using do not eat, drink, smoke, sniff.

Fire prevention

Only use the material in places where open light, fire and other flammable sources can be kept away. Keep away from sources of ignition - No smoking. Vapours are heavier than air, spread along floors and form explosive mixtures with air. Take precautionary measures against static discharges. Provide earthing of containers, equipment, pumps and ventilation facilities.

Exposure Controls / PPE

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and protective equipment

Engineering

If technical exhaust or ventilation measures are not possible or insufficient, respiratory protection must be worn.

Hands

Use protective gloves in accordance with EN 374. Please observe the intended use instructions and permeation times of the glove manufacturer! The indicated permeation times are valid for full contact activities. Full contact gloves should offer permeation times over 120 minutes. Gloves with shorter permeation times are only suitable for short term contact. Contaminated gloves should be disposed of immediately, splattered gloves should be disposed of after the maximum wear time has been reached, at the latest at the end of the work shift. Suitable material for work with short term contact: nitrile-based rubber, e.g. Camatril made by KCL, or comparable products. Material thickness > 0,4mm. Permeation time > 60 minutes. Suitable material for work with long, intensive, or multiple contact: fluorocarbon rubber, e.g. Viton made by KCL or comparable products. Material thickness > 0,7mm. Permeation time > 480 minutes.

Eyes

Eye glasses with side protection DIN EN 166

Respiratory

If technical exhaust or ventilation measures are not possible or insufficient, respiratory protection must be worn. Respiratory protection necessary at: exceeding exposure limit values. Suitable respiratory protection apparatus: Combination filtering device (EN 14387)

Skin/Body

Required properties antistatic. Recommended material Natural fibres (e.g. cotton)
